Job Description
We are seeking a Process Engineer to support a leading pharmaceutical company. This candidate will support the Biologics INnovation Xceleration (BioNX) facility at Dunboyne. By integrating leading-edge technology with a dynamic, activity-based workspace, the facility will support seamless connection and collaboration within and across teams and functions. The BioNX Facility will provide Biologics Drug Substance manufacturing for Clinical Supply, Registration & Commercial Launch.
As a member of the Manufacturing Technologies and Engineering group, you will be responsible for the evaluation and implementation of novel equipment, innovative processes, and the implementation of next-generation technologies to keep our company at the forefront of innovation in the development and manufacturing of biologics.
